Federal enforcement history

Federal regulators have imposed 3 enforcement actions against this facility, including 2 civil money penalties totaling $99,959 and 1 payment-denial actions spanning 79 days.

DateTypeFinePayment denial
Nov 28, 2024Fine$57,125
Apr 9, 2024Fine$42,834
Apr 9, 2024Payment DenialJun 1, 2024 · 79 days
About this record A citation is a finding by a state survey team working under federal contract. It is not a court judgment. The description above is drawn verbatim from federal public datasets. Facilities have the right to appeal findings through an Informal Dispute Resolution (IDR/IIDR) process.
